Techniques for Preparing Silicone Baking Molds

Prepping Your Mold Before Baking

Most silicone molds stick little naturally. But good prep gives the best outcomes. Begin by washing the mold with warm soapy water. This removes factory leftover or old oil. Let it dry fully before using.

For the first time or sticky mixes like caramel or fudge brownies, add a light coat of butter or spray. This boosts release without harming the non-stick side.

Filling Silicone Baking Molds Correctly

Fill your silicone baking mold evenly across the spots. This ensures even cooking. Use a spoon or piping bag for accuracy in small shapes like mini cupcakes or chocolates. Do not fill over two-thirds full. This stops spills as it rises in the oven.

Put the bendy mold on a firm baking sheet before adding mix. This gives support when moving to the oven. It matters for runny batters that might spill.

Achieving Perfect Release with Silicone Baking Molds

Tips for Ensuring a Smooth Release

After baking, let the item cool enough before taking it out. Cooling helps it set a bit. It pulls away from the walls on its own. Then, softly bend the mold sides or push from below. This frees items without ripping soft parts.

For detailed shapes like bundt cakes or molded chocolates, a short fridge chill helps. It shrinks the material a touch for easier release.

Troubleshooting Common Release Issues

If it sticks even after good prep, check for leftover bits after washing. Sticky areas might come from sugar hardening or not enough cooling. Change bake times too. Underbaked items stick more than set ones.

Heat differences affect feel. If sides brown fast but middles stay soft, lower oven heat a bit. Or add time slowly until results balance.

Care and Maintenance of Silicone Baking Molds

Cleaning and Storing Your Silicone Molds

Good care makes your mold last longer. Wash it right after use with gentle soap. Skip rough scrubbers that might mark the surface. For tough grease, soak in warm water with vinegar. Then rinse well.

Dry it fully before putting away. Wetness in creases can lead to bad smells later. Store flat in drawers or hang on hooks. This avoids shape loss.

Extending the Lifespan of Your Silicone Molds

Do not put molds near open fire or sharp tools that might poke holes. Avoid slicing baked items inside the molds. Move them to a board first.

To keep non-stick working over time, limit oily sprays with lecithin buildup. These can coat surfaces. Use light neutral oil brushes if needed.
